This position is for a Postdoctoral Researcher who will play a key role in advancing research excellence in sensing technologies. The role involves contributing to a major industry-aligned project funded by the Australian Government through the Australian Research Council’s Industrial Transformation Research Programme.
This position will work as part of a collaborative team, working closely with fellow postdoctoral researchers and PhD candidates across ARC Research Hub for Molecular Biosensors at Point-of-Use (MOBIUS) and other research groups focused on molecular biosensing for point-of-use applications.
The primary objective of MOBIUS is to accelerate the growth of Australia’s biosensing industry. The Hub brings together industry, government, and academic experts from diverse fields in chemistry, biology, physics, and engineering to collaborate on complex problems and generate new commercial opportunities. It also aims to build an ecosystem to train the next generation of biosensor researchers through deep engagement of researchers and students with industry.
